One possible reason is that the raid information may be at the start of
the partition. You want to be using version 0.9 or 1.0. The default version
is 1.2. When installing anaconda gives the /boot partition the appropriate
version when creating the array. You can check the version with mdadm -D .
One note on this. The man page info for the -e option is incorrect. -e 1
is equivalent to -e 1.2, not -e 1.0 is stated in the man page.
